Commercial Slab Construction in Marietta, GA
Commercial slab construction services involve the installation of concrete foundations and flooring for a variety of commercial projects, including retail stores, warehouses, office buildings, and industrial facilities. This process typically includes preparing the site, pouring and leveling the concrete slab, and ensuring proper reinforcement to support heavy loads and long-term durability.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the standard material for commercial slabs due to its durability and strength,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h.
How does site preparation affect commercial slab construction? Proper site preparation ensures a stable base, reduces the risk of cracking, and helps achieve a level surface for the slab.
What factors influence the design of a commercial slab? The intended use, load requirements, and local soil conditions are key factors in determining the slab's thickness and reinforcement needs.
